White House Seeks Financial Crisis-Era Powers to Buttress Economy
by: Alan Rappeport; Jeanna Smialek
Treasury Secretary Steven Mnuchin said on Sunday that he would ask Congress to reinstate powers that were used during the 2008 financial crisis to support the economy during the current crisis. “Certain tools were taken away that I'm going to go back to Congress and ask for,” Mnuchin said in an interview, referring to regulations that were imposed by Dodd-Frank. The law, among other things, took away Treasury's ability to use a program, known as the Exchange Stabilization Fund, to guarantee money market funds.
